penal
1 of 1adjective/ˈpinəl/
1
relating to punishment, especially by law or regulation
- The penal code outlines the legal framework for determining criminal offenses and their associated punishments.
- Penal institutions, such as prisons and correctional facilities, are designed to house individuals convicted of crimes.
- A penal sentence was handed down by the judge, imposing a term of imprisonment for the convicted felon.
- Legal scholars study the effectiveness and fairness of penal systems in achieving justice and social order.
- Penal laws serve to deter individuals from engaging in criminal behavior by imposing consequences for wrongdoing.
2
(of an act or offense) subject to punishment by law
